Mozzarella, Tomato and Basil Skewers

These easy pickings are perfect to snack on this summer! All you need are mozzarella balls, basil leaves, and cherry tomatoes. Also, add some extra-virgin olive oil and some salt and pepper. Thread mozzarella, basil, and tomato onto a mini skewer and drizzle some olive oil, salt, and pepper – voila it’s ready to snack on!

Bite-sized Strawberry and Brie

This bite-sized snack is not only refreshing but easy to make too! To start, make sure you have strawberries, basil leaves, brie cheese, and balsamic glaze. Thread the strawberry, basil, and piece of brie cheese onto toothpicks. When you are done drizzle the balsamic to finish it off.

Classic Hummus

Who doesn’t like a healthy dip to enjoy? This easy-to-make hummus is a nutritious and delicious snack to create with your loved one. You will need smashed and peeled garlic cloves, rinsed chickpeas, lemon juice, extra-virgin olive oil, tahini, and salt. In a mixer add the garlic, until minced, add chickpeas, lemon juice, oil, tahini, and salt. Mix until smooth. Don’t forget to add your sides! Sliced bell peppers or carrots are a great healthy choice!
